The Water Framework Directive, commonly known in Finnish as vesipuitedirektiivi, is a cornerstone piece of European Union legislation aimed at protecting and improving the quality of water bodies. Officially Directive 2000/60/EC, it establishes a framework for the management of water resources across the EU member states. Its primary objective is to achieve "good status" for all rivers, lakes, groundwater, and coastal waters by 2015, with subsequent deadlines for more challenging objectives.
The directive emphasizes an integrated approach to water management, considering all aspects of the aquatic environment.
